Norman Knights Tournament at Arundel Castle - 14 - 15 July 2018

The weekend of 14 and 15 July 2018 will see a Norman Knights tournament of Norman foot combat held on the upper grounds of Arundel Castle. Along with a tented encampment, which will include a variety of crafts and demonstrations of the period, as well as a falconry display, have-a-go-archery for the over 8s and a storyteller to enthrall and excite visitors. Four Nations Medieval Tournament at Arundel Castle - 23 -24 June 2018

The Four Nations Medieval Tournament at Arundel Castle is back on 23 -24 June 2018. The knights, squires, and men at arms of Raven Tor Living History Group will meet in a medieval foot tournament representing four historical nations.
